Kicking off with calculate outliers, this dialogue will delve into the importance of outliers in datasets and the way they’ll influence information evaluation. Outliers are information factors which might be considerably completely different from the vast majority of the info, and figuring out them is essential in understanding the distribution of the info.
The strategies for detecting and calculating outliers in univariate information, such because the Z-score methodology, IQR methodology, and modified Z-score methodology, shall be mentioned intimately. Moreover, using statistical strategies equivalent to Mahalanobis distance and principal part evaluation (PCA) for detecting outliers in multivariate information shall be explored.
Understanding the Idea of Outliers and Their Significance in Knowledge Units
Outliers are information factors that deviate considerably from different observations, and recognizing them is an important step in information evaluation. Consider it like looking for a uncommon gem in a large pile of grime – you gotta know what you are searching for. Figuring out outliers can considerably influence decision-making, particularly in fields like finance, healthcare, and science. A single outlier can skew the complete dataset, resulting in flawed conclusions or suggestions.
Idea of Outliers vs Anomalies
Outliers and anomalies are sometimes used interchangeably, however technically, an anomaly is an information level that’s sudden, whereas an outlier is an information level that’s unusually removed from the norm. Consider it like this: an anomaly is like discovering a unicorn within the forest, whereas an outlier is like discovering that the unicorn has a pair of wings – it defies expectations. To tell apart between the 2, contemplate the context and whether or not the info level is really anomalous or simply an outlier as a result of uncommon circumstances.
Actual-World Situations: When Outliers Matter
Think about you are against the law analyst finding out the distribution of theft frequencies in a metropolis. On the floor, the info exhibits a typical sample, however you then discover a small city with an unusually excessive incidence of robberies – 10 instances the speed of the subsequent closest city. Is that this city actually that crime-prone, or is there an unknown issue at play? A extra detailed investigation would possibly reveal a high-security facility has not too long ago moved in, contributing to an outlier. This tiny perception may shift the course of the evaluation, influencing how sources are allotted to stop future robberies.
Affect of Outliers on Knowledge Evaluation
Ignoring outliers can distort your complete understanding of the info. Consider it like making an attempt to navigate by a forest and not using a map. If you happen to do not account for outliers, you would possibly find yourself misplaced in a sea of deceptive conclusions. However, figuring out and addressing outliers lets you refine your evaluation, revealing extra correct insights. Within the context of the crime evaluation talked about earlier, ignoring the high-security facility may need led the analyst to conclude that the city is inherently crime-prone, when in actuality, the presence of the ability skewed the info.
Instance: Inventory Market Knowledge
Take into account the inventory market – think about you are making an attempt to foretell inventory costs primarily based on historic information. If a selected inventory reveals unusually erratic conduct, it is perhaps thought of an outlier. If not accounted for, this inventory’s conduct would possibly throw off the complete mannequin, resulting in disastrous funding choices. Nonetheless, by figuring out and accounting for this outlier, you possibly can create a extra sturdy mannequin that anticipates the inventory’s conduct, decreasing the danger of great losses.
Visualizing Outliers with Plots
A easy but efficient method to spot outliers is through the use of plots like scatter plots, field plots, or histograms. These graphics can visually reveal the distribution of information, highlighting these information factors that stand out as considerably completely different from the norm. By eye-balling these plots, you possibly can immediately establish information factors that do not belong, making it simpler to analyze and tackle potential points.
Strategies for Detecting and Calculating Outliers in Univariate Knowledge
Calculating outliers is all about discovering these information factors which might be a bit too far out from the remainder of the bunch. In univariate information, which is information with one kind of measurement per information level, there are a number of strategies to detect and calculate outliers.
Now, let’s dive into the commonest strategies.
The Z-Rating Technique
The Z-Rating methodology is without doubt one of the oldest and most generally used strategies to detect outliers in univariate information. It offers a standardized method to specific what number of customary deviations an information level is away from the imply. The components for the Z-Rating is
Z = (X – μ) / σ
the place X is the info level, μ is the imply, and σ is the usual deviation.
To find out if an information level is an outlier utilizing the Z-Rating methodology, we are able to set a sure threshold worth for the Z-Rating. For instance, if we set the brink to be greater than 2 customary deviations away from the imply, any information level with a Z-Rating higher than 2 or lower than -2 can be thought of an outlier. This threshold worth will be adjusted primarily based on the info and the particular use case.
The Interquartile Vary (IQR) Technique
The IQR methodology is one other well-liked methodology for detecting outliers in univariate information. It entails calculating the interquartile vary (IQR), which is the distinction between the seventy fifth percentile (Q3) and the twenty fifth percentile (Q1) of the info. The IQR methodology then determines if an information level is an outlier by checking if it falls under Q1 – 1.5(IQR) or above Q3 + 1.5(IQR).
The Modified Z-Rating Technique
The modified Z-Rating methodology is a variation of the Z-Rating methodology that takes into consideration the outliers when calculating the usual deviation. This methodology is extra sturdy to outliers than the usual Z-Rating methodology and may present extra correct outcomes.
Comparability of Strategies
Every of those strategies has its professionals and cons. The Z-Rating methodology is straightforward to know and calculate, however it may be delicate to outliers. The IQR methodology is extra sturdy to outliers, however it may be extra computationally intensive. The modified Z-Rating methodology offers a great steadiness between the 2, however it may be extra complicated to calculate.
Finally, the selection of methodology will depend on the particular use case and the traits of the info. For instance, if the info is very skewed or has outliers, the IQR methodology could also be a better option. If the info is often distributed, the Z-Rating methodology could also be enough. The modified Z-Rating methodology can be utilized as a fallback or when the info is very complicated.
Examples
Let’s contemplate an instance of a dataset with 10 information factors: 1, 2, 3, 4, 5, 6, 7, 8, 9, 100. Utilizing the Z-Rating methodology, the imply is 4 and the usual deviation is 2.33. The Z-Rating for the info level 100 is (100 – 4) / 2.33 = 40.95, which is greater than 2 customary deviations away from the imply and can be thought of an outlier.
Equally, let’s contemplate one other dataset with 10 information factors: 10, 20, 30, 40, 50, 60, 70, 80, 90, 200. Utilizing the IQR methodology, Q1 is 20 and Q3 is 60. The IQR is 40. An information level of 200 is greater than 1.5(IQR) = 60 away from Q3 and can be thought of an outlier.
In each circumstances, the info level 100 and 200 are thought of outliers as they’re greater than 2 customary deviations away from the imply and 1.5(IQR) away from Q3, respectively.
Conclusion
In conclusion, there are a number of strategies for detecting and calculating outliers in univariate information, every with its personal professionals and cons. The Z-Rating methodology, IQR methodology, and modified Z-Rating methodology are a number of the most generally used strategies. The selection of methodology will depend on the particular use case and the traits of the info. By understanding these strategies and their functions, you possibly can detect and calculate outliers with higher accuracy and confidence.
Blud, Outliers in Time Sequence Knowledge and Financial Knowledge
Figuring out outliers in time collection information and financial information could be a proper correct problem, innit? It is like tryin’ to discover a needle in a haystack, however with a great deal of complicated numbers and patterns. You gotta know what you are lookin’ for and the place to look.
Time collection information, like financial indicators or inventory costs, will be tremendous delicate to outliers. A single rogue worth can skew the entire dataset, makin’ it laborious to identify developments or patterns. Financial information, like GDP progress charges or inflation charges, will also be affected by outliers, resulting in inaccurate predictions or choices.
Figuring out Outliers in Time Sequence Knowledge, Tips on how to calculate outliers
To establish outliers in time collection information, you have to use some fancy statistical strategies, fam. The primary one’s autocorrelation exams, which checks for patterns within the information over time. If the info’s not autocorrelated, it is perhaps as a result of an outlier.
One other trick is to make use of heteroscedasticity exams, which checks for modifications within the information’s unfold over time. If the unfold’s not constant, it is perhaps as a result of an outlier, bruv.
For instance, for example you are analyzing inventory costs over the previous yr. If you happen to discover an enormous spike in value on a single day, that is perhaps an outlier. You need to use statistical software program to test for autocorrelation and heteroscedasticity and see if it is associated to that single day.
Utilizing Autocorrelation and Heteroscedasticity Assessments
Listed here are some steps to make use of autocorrelation and heteroscedasticity exams to establish outliers in time collection information:
- Gather and put together your time collection information, ensuring it is cleaned and tidy.
- Run an autocorrelation take a look at to see if there are any patterns within the information over time.
- Run a heteroscedasticity take a look at to see if there are any modifications within the information’s unfold over time.
- Verify the outcomes of each exams to see in the event that they point out any outliers.
- Use statistical software program to visualise the info and establish the outlier.
If the info’s not autocorrelated or heteroscedastic, it is perhaps as a result of an outlier. You may then use different strategies, like regression evaluation or machine studying algorithms, to establish the outlier and proper it.
Calculating Outliers in Financial Knowledge
Financial information, like GDP progress charges or inflation charges, will also be affected by outliers. To calculate outliers in financial information, you should utilize statistical strategies like regression evaluation or machine studying algorithms.
For instance, for example you are analyzing GDP progress charges over the previous decade. If you happen to discover an enormous progress charge in a single yr, that is perhaps an outlier. You need to use regression evaluation to see if that progress charge is said to different elements, like modifications in rates of interest or authorities insurance policies.
- Gather and put together your financial information, ensuring it is cleaned and tidy.
- Run a regression evaluation to see if there are any relationships between the info factors.
- Verify the residuals of the regression evaluation to see if there are any outliers.
- Use machine studying algorithms to establish the outlier and proper it.
Through the use of these statistical strategies, you possibly can establish and proper outliers in time collection information and financial information, makin’ it simpler to identify developments and patterns.
A great information analyst is sort of a detective, lookin’ for clues and patterns within the information.
Knowledge Cleansing and Preprocessing: The Key to Correct Outlier Identification: How To Calculate Outliers
Within the realm of information evaluation, information cleansing and preprocessing are sometimes missed however essential steps in figuring out and calculating outliers. A well-preprocessed dataset can enormously enhance the accuracy and reliability of outlier detection strategies. Consider information cleansing as hunting down the dangerous seeds in a backyard, permitting your evaluation to flourish.
Knowledge cleansing entails eradicating or correcting errors and inconsistencies within the information, whereas preprocessing transforms the info right into a format that is amenable to evaluation. This would possibly contain dealing with lacking values, eradicating duplicates, and scaling or normalizing the info.
Eradicating Duplicates and Dealing with Lacking Values
Duplicates can result in deceptive outcomes, so it is important to take away them earlier than analyzing the info. Equally, lacking values could cause issues for outlier detection algorithms, which can interpret these values as anomalies. There are a number of methods to deal with lacking values, together with:
- Ignoring them: If the proportion of lacking values is low, you possibly can merely ignore them and proceed with the evaluation. Nonetheless, this would possibly result in biased outcomes if the lacking values will not be randomly distributed.
- Imputing them: You need to use statistical fashions or machine studying algorithms to estimate the lacking values. This strategy is appropriate when the lacking values are anticipated to be random and unrelated to the variables of curiosity.
- Deleting them: If the lacking values are intensive or systematic, it is higher to delete the corresponding rows or information. This strategy would possibly cut back the pattern measurement however can assist forestall biased outcomes.
Eradicating duplicates and dealing with lacking values requires a mixture of handbook inspection and automatic strategies. For instance, you should utilize the "duplicated()" operate in R to establish duplicate rows and the "is.na()" operate to establish lacking values.
Remodeling Knowledge: Scaling and Normalization
Scaling and normalization are important preprocessing steps when coping with numerical information, particularly when utilizing distance-based outlier detection strategies just like the k-nearest neighbors algorithm. These strategies work on the magnitude of the info, so outliers may not be detected appropriately if the info isn’t scaled appropriately.
Scaling: Scaling the info entails remodeling it to have a imply of zero and a typical deviation of 1. That is helpful for algorithms which might be delicate to the magnitude of the info.
Visualizing the Knowledge Cleansing Course of
Visualizing the info cleansing course of can assist you monitor the progress and establish potential outliers. You need to use information visualization instruments like Tableau, Energy BI, or D3.js to create interactive dashboards that will let you drill down into particular areas of the info.
- Use bar charts or histograms to visualise the distribution of the variables.
- Use scatter plots to visualise the relationships between variables.
- Use warmth maps to visualise the correlation matrix.
By leveraging information visualization instruments, you possibly can achieve insights into the info cleansing course of and make knowledgeable choices about proceed with the evaluation.
Greatest Practices for Knowledge Cleansing and Preprocessing
Listed here are some greatest practices to bear in mind when cleansing and preprocessing your information:
- Doc your cleansing and preprocessing steps to make sure reproducibility.
- Use automation instruments to streamline the info cleansing course of.
- Monitor the info cleansing course of to establish potential issues.
Utilizing Machine Studying Algorithms to Establish and Calculate Outliers
Machine studying algorithms are a cracking method to establish and calculate outliers in your information. They work by studying patterns and relationships inside the information, after which utilizing that data to flag up the bizarre values.
Determination Timber
Determination timber are a sort of machine studying algorithm that work by recursively partitioning the info into smaller and smaller subsets till they attain a leaf node. Every leaf node corresponds to a selected classification or prediction, and the algorithm will be educated to establish outliers by searching for situations that fall outdoors of the traditional sample.
A method to make use of determination timber to establish outliers is to coach the algorithm to foretell a steady worth, equivalent to an individual’s revenue or an organization’s income. The algorithm can then be evaluated to see how properly it performs on the coaching information, and any situations that fall outdoors of the ninety fifth percentile will be flagged up as potential outliers.
- Prepare a call tree algorithm to foretell the shopper’s whole spend.
- Use the algorithm to judge the coaching information and establish any situations that fall outdoors of the ninety fifth percentile.
- Flag up any prospects who’re spending greater than the typical quantity as potential outliers.
Clustering
Clustering is one other kind of machine studying algorithm that can be utilized to establish outliers. Clustering algorithms work by grouping related situations collectively, and the algorithm will be educated to establish outliers by searching for situations that do not match properly with any of the clusters.
A method to make use of clustering to establish outliers is to coach the algorithm to foretell a cluster membership for every occasion. The algorithm can then be evaluated to see how properly it performs on the coaching information, and any situations that do not match properly with any of the clusters will be flagged up as potential outliers.
- Prepare a clustering algorithm, equivalent to Ok-Means or Hierarchical Clustering, to foretell a cluster membership for every buyer.
- Use the algorithm to judge the coaching information and establish any situations that do not match properly with any of the clusters.
- Flag up any prospects who’re shopping for considerably extra of a selected product than the typical buyer as potential outliers.
Pruning
Pruning is a method that can be utilized to cut back the dimensions of a call tree mannequin, which can assist to stop overfitting and enhance the accuracy of the mannequin. Pruning will be notably helpful when working with giant datasets, as it could assist to hurry up the coaching course of and enhance the efficiency of the mannequin.
- Prepare a call tree algorithm to foretell the shopper’s whole spend.
- Use pruning to cut back the dimensions of the mannequin.
- Use the pruned mannequin to establish any prospects who’re spending greater than the typical quantity as potential outliers.
Analysis
As soon as a machine studying mannequin has been educated to establish outliers, it is important to judge its efficiency utilizing metrics equivalent to precision, recall, and F1-score. This may assist to make sure that the mannequin is correct and dependable.
- Use metrics equivalent to precision, recall, and F1-score to judge the efficiency of the mannequin.
- Evaluate the outcomes to a baseline mannequin, equivalent to a random forest mannequin, to see how properly the choice tree mannequin performs relative to a extra complicated mannequin.
Greatest Practices for Calculating and Coping with Outliers in Knowledge
In relation to coping with outliers in information, it is all about being methodical and thorough. You gotta have a strong recreation plan in place to precisely establish and deal with these pesky information factors.
To start out off, utilizing sturdy statistical strategies is the best way to go. These strategies are designed to resist the affect of outliers, offering a extra correct image of your information. For instance, you should utilize the interquartile vary (IQR) to calculate the vary of your information, ignoring the outliers. This will provide you with a greater sense of the standard values in your dataset.
Visualizing Knowledge Distributions
Visualizing your information is a no brainer relating to figuring out outliers. By making a histogram or a field plot, you possibly can see at a look the place the outliers are hiding. These visuals will provide you with a transparent concept of the form and distribution of your information, serving to you pinpoint these rogue values.
- Use histograms to see the distribution of your information. This will provide you with a visible illustration of the info’s unfold and any potential outliers.
- Create a field plot to get a snapshot of the info’s median, quartiles, and outliers.
- Preserve a watch out for skewness in your information. In case your information is closely skewed, it may be more durable to establish outliers.
Speaking Outlier Outcomes to Stakeholders
Speaking your findings to stakeholders is simply as essential as figuring out the outliers themselves. You gotta be clear and concise in your reporting, making it simple for others to know the implications of those rogue values.
- Be particular concerning the strategies you used to establish the outliers.
- Use visuals for instance your findings, making it simple for stakeholders to see the influence of the outliers.
- Spotlight the important thing takeaways out of your evaluation, specializing in an important insights.
Inventive Reporting Examples
In relation to reporting your findings, be inventive and assume outdoors the field. Use charts, graphs, and visualizations to make your information come alive. A great report ought to be simple to know and visually interesting.
- Create an interactive dashboard to discover the info and outliers.
- Use color-coding to focus on essential developments and patterns.
- Develop a story to elucidate the insights and implications of the outlier outcomes.
Final result Abstract
In conclusion, calculating outliers is a crucial step in information evaluation, as it could assist establish anomalies, enhance the accuracy of fashions, and supply insights into information distributions. Through the use of the proper strategies and strategies, information analysts and scientists can precisely detect and deal with outliers in univariate and multivariate information, main to raised decision-making and outcomes.
FAQ Insights
What’s an outlier in a dataset?
An outlier is an information level that’s considerably completely different from the vast majority of the info, usually as a result of errors or uncommon circumstances.
Why is it essential to establish outliers?
Figuring out outliers is essential in understanding the distribution of the info, as they’ll considerably influence information evaluation and modeling outcomes.
What are some widespread strategies for detecting outliers in univariate information?
Widespread strategies for detecting outliers in univariate information embrace the Z-score methodology, IQR methodology, and modified Z-score methodology.
What’s Mahalanobis distance and the way is it used for outlier detection?
Mahalanobis distance is a statistical measure used to detect outliers in multivariate information by calculating the space of every information level from the middle of the info distribution.